摘要
Agricultural structure adjustment is an important measure to promote the development of ecological agriculture by the Chinese government, and the construction of ecological agriculture demonstration park is an important part of the agricultural structure adjustment. This paper studied the Qi River ecological agriculture demonstration zone located in Hebi, China, and formulated the overall planning program based on the SWOT analysis, ecological suitability analysis and market demand analysis. The results are the following: Nine functional zones are established based on its development positioning, namely, eco-harvesting zone, leisure village, fun farm zone, facility agricultural zone, technology demonstration zone, recreational zone, Qi River original ecological experience zone, agribusiness incubator zone, and development reserve zone. Special planning for road transportation system, water system, and infrastructure should be fully integrated. Eco-agriculture demonstration zone is an important direction of China's modern agricultural development, and its rational planning can help to improve the sustainability of the park's development.
